A CURRY lunch and auction of promises at The Longhouse at Mill on the Brue on Sunday raised more than £3,000 for St Margaret's Hospice.

About 100 supporters, many with personal experience of the care and wonderful atmosphere at the Yeovil hospice, enjoyed the lunch prepared by Mill on the Brue staff, with ingredients that were all given by local producers and retailers.

In the spring, Tricia Rawlingson-Plant, one of the founders of the Bruton activity centre, is going on a trek to the Himalayas in India to raise funds for the hospice, where her husband Tony died in 2009.

She is paying for the trek herself, and all the money raised on Sunday will go to the hospice.
